Djobet's 27 lead Omaha past Denver 84-82
Published Jan. 31, 2026 6:40 p.m. ET
Associated Press
DENVER (AP) — Paul Djobet scored 27 points as Omaha beat Denver 84-82 on Saturday.
Djobet had 11 rebounds for the Mavericks (12-12, 5-4 Summit League). Ja'Sean Glover scored 19 points, shooting 6 of 12 (3 of 7 from 3-point range) and 4 of 4 from the free-throw line. Grant Stubblefield shot 7 of 11 from the field and 2 of 3 from the free-throw line to finish with 17 points.
Zane Nelson finished with 19 points, seven rebounds and four assists for the Pioneers (10-14, 3-6). Carson Johnson added 19 points and four assists for Denver. Jeremiah Burke had 18 points.
